Резюме
Expresses grave concern at the continued Afghan war and the ethnic nature of the conflict; urges all parties to stop the fighting, to agree on a ceasefire and engage in a political dialogue; deplores the active political and military support from outside Afghanistan to the factions; expresses concern at the continuing discrimination against girls and women and other violations of human rights as well as international humanitarian law; supports the steps to launch investigations into alleged mass killings of prisoners of war and civilians; expresses concern at the sharp deterioration of the humanitarian situation in central and north Afghanistan and urges the Taliban to let the humanitarian agencies attend to the needs of the population.
